WHEEL LOCKING ASSEMBLY AND METHOD

A wheel locking assembly is provided for securing a wheel to a wheel hub of a motor vehicle. That wheel locking assembly includes a locking cylinder and a wheel retainer. The wheel retainer is displaceable by means of the locking cylinder between an unlocked position, allowing removal of the wheel from the wheel hub and a locked position securing the wheel to the wheel hub. A related method for securing a wheel to a wheel hub of a motor vehicle is also disclosed.

Wheel and mudcover

A wheel with a tire bead area, in which a tire bead sits, and an aero lip which provides structural integrity to the wheel and anchors the part of the wheel that secures and protects a mudcover. Inside of the aero lip is a cover insert that protects the mudcover. The mudcover rests against a cover support ledge, and is bolted with a mudcover bolt into a threaded insert that is held by a cover tab . The mudcover is bolted directly to the wheel, as opposed to the prior art. The mudcover bolt can also be a twist-rivet or nut-rivet combination.

WHEEL AXLE ASSEMBLY

A releasable wheel assembly includes a bracket having multiple bosses, each boss including a hole that receives an axle. A pair of wheels are mounted on the axle and a pair of locking caps fit over respective ends of the axle, the locking caps each including a clip for engaging the axle at a circumferential groove to prevent movement of the locking cap along the axle. The wheel assembly can be mounted to a carry bag or other storage unit by mounting the bracket to the storage unit, where the wheels and axle can be easily removed from the bracket.

WHEEL COVER

A commercial vehicle wheel cover including a wheel cover assembly having at least two hinge points, at least two handles, and at least two cam latch mechanisms. The wheel cover assembly has a front side and a back side, with at least two handles attached via at least two hinge points attached to at least two interlocking cam latch mechanisms arranged integrally on the wheel cover. The wheel cover assembly is attached to the hub via at least two cam latch mechanisms which lock into a collar assembly. The collar assembly consists of at least two collar halves and a latch that, when installed, applies a compressive force on the axle hub flange holding the assembly to the hub. Each of the at least two collars contain retention features that receive the interlocking features of the cam latch mechanism of the wheel cover assembly.

Broken axle recovery apparatus

A broken axle recovery apparatus that provides a temporary solution for a broken semi floating rear axle shaft has a wheel hub, a backing plate and a bearing. The wheel hub is rotatably engaged with the backing plate via the bearing in such a way that the broken axle recovery apparatus enables a rear wheel to be functionally mounted onto a vehicle. The backing plate is mounted to an axle housing of the vehicle, and the rear wheel is rotatably mounted to the wheel hub. The bearing enables the wheel hub and the rear wheel to freely rotate about the axle housing so that the vehicle can be safely driven into a safe location or a mechanic shop.

Hub cap data repeater circuit

A system includes a wheel, a hubcap coupled to the wheel and a tire pressure sensor coupled to the wheel. The system also includes a brake control unit (BCU) and an active hubcap circuit coupled to the hubcap. The active hubcap circuit is electrically coupled to the tire pressure sensor and the BCU and configured to receive an input signal from at least one of the tire pressure sensor or the BCU, generate an output signal by increasing a signal to noise ratio of the input signal and output the output signal to at least one of the BCU or the tire pressure sensor.

ROTARY UNION WITH ENERGY HARVESTING STRUCTURE

A rotary union for a tire inflation system of a heavy-duty vehicle that includes energy harvesting structure for generating electricity to power electronic components of the heavy-duty vehicle. The energy harvesting structure is integrated with and protected by the rotary union. The energy harvesting structure includes components that are attached to respective static and rotatable components of the rotary union that generate electricity for powering the electronic components during rotational movement of the rotatable components relative to the static components during operation of the heavy-duty vehicle. The components of the energy harvesting structure can be entirely removed or separated and sealed from a flow path of pressurized air through the rotary union.

Wheel with interchangeable caps

Systems, apparatus, devices, brackets, assemblies, and methods for a wheel hub with interchangeable caps for changing the appearance of wheels having exposed lug nuts about a center hole. A bracket invention having both a small cap and a large cap can be used on an existing wheel which exposes a center hole and the lug nuts. A smaller cap can be used to cover only the center hole of the wheel. A larger cap can be used to cover both the center hole and the exposed lug nuts on the wheel. An adapter ring can be used for OEM (original equipment manufacturer) wheels to allow for using the base that allows for either a small cap or large cap to be interchangeably used to change the exterior appearance of the wheel. The bracket can be integrated with the wheel, or be attachable onto the wheel. The caps can be mounted and dismounted by pressing and rotating spring biased emblems with either ball bearings or studs from the bases.

Vehicle wheel cover retention system and method for producing same

The vehicle wheel cover retention system comprises a wheel including a first hub hole provided therein which has a retention member formed in a generally axially extending portion thereof. The wheel cover includes a second hub hole provided therein. The second hub hole includes an annular axially extending segmented projection. The segmented projection includes a chamfered outer circumferential surface and a shoulder provided thereon. During assembly, the segmented projection deflects radially inward as the wheel cover is initially installed and moved toward the retention member and then as the wheel cover is further advanced the segmented projection moves radially outward to enable the shoulder to engage the retention member to thereby secure the wheel cover to the wheel. The center cap includes an annular axially extending projection. The center cap is then installed and its annular extending projection engages with the inside of the segmented projection of the wheel cover, thus preventing it to further deflect radially inward and thereby locking the wheel cover to the wheel.
